Ukraine To Start Producing Combat UAVs In Germany For The First Time
Photo: Sven Hoppe/picture alliance via Getty Images

Kiev plans to conclude a dozen more such agreements in the coming year.

A Ukrainian defense startup has signed a 100 million euro deal to produce drones in Germany. Kiev plans to sign a dozen more such deals in the coming year to significantly ramp up production, start selling its products to Western allies and reduce dependence on China, the Financial Times reports.

Founded in 2022, Frontline will open a factory in southern Germany in partnership with Bavarian reconnaissance drone manufacturer Quantum Systems.

The Ukrainian side of the joint venture will get intellectual property and combat experience, while the German side will get automated capabilities At the plant worth 40 million euros in 2026 it is planned to produce 10 thousand drones, which will be sent to Ukraine. After that, the companies will have the right to export the devices to other countries.

According to Matthias Lena of Quantum, who will head the JV, the company is already in talks with the Bundeswehr about supplying it with new drones. Oleksandr Kamyshyn, a freelance strategic adviser to the Ukrainian president, told the FT that the JV should be the first of 10 such projects planned for Europe over the next year.
